Shao-Hua Hu (胡少華) has been competing for 9 years. His best event is the Skewb: a personal-best single of 2.98, set at Taiwan Championship 2018, puts him in the top 4.9% of the 73,281 people who have ever been ranked in the event, and 46th in Chinese Taipei. Until February 2014, no official Skewb solve in the world had been that fast. Across 13 competitions since February 2018, he has put 603 official solves on the record across twelve events. Solve to solve, his 3×3 times vary about 13% around a typical one, steadier than 58% of the 35,811 competitors with ten or more counted rounds. His 2×2 best has come down from 5.14 in February 2018 to 2.32, a 55% improvement. He has entered 13 competitions, more competitions than 94% of everyone who has ever competed.

Reading this page: a single is one solve's time · an average is the middle three of five solves, best and worst discarded · a PB is a personal best · a DNF (did not finish) is an attempt with no valid result: a popped piece, an unsolved face, an over-limit memorisation · top X% compares against everyone ever ranked in that event, which is fairer than raw rank because event pools differ tenfold.
